How everyday chemicals fuel breast cancer from the inside out

% of readers think this story is Fact. Add your two cents.


phthalates-drive-breast-cancer-risk(NaturalHealth365)  Walk down any supermarket aisle and you’ll see a massive amount of plastic surrounding so many products.  This synthetic material cradles your food, coats your cosmetics, and even lines the medical devices meant to keep you alive.  But behind the glossy packaging lies an invisible threat: phthalates.

These synthetic chemicals, used to make plastics flexible and fragrances linger, are now being implicated in something far darker than environmental clutter.  According to a recent review in Ecotoxicology and Environmental Safety, phthalates may not just disrupt hormones.  They may actively help breast cancer grow, spread, and resist treatment.

For decades, regulators assured us that trace amounts of phthalates were “harmless.”  After all, they pass quickly through the body.  But the latest science suggests otherwise: repeated, low-level exposures can trigger changes at the cellular level that set the stage for breast carcinogenesis.  In other words, it’s not the dose you notice; it’s the dose that keeps accumulating invisibly, day after day.

The Trojan horse of modern life

Phthalates are everywhere: vinyl flooring, food packaging, personal care products, and even children’s toys.  Because they aren’t chemically bound to plastics, they “leak” into the air you breathe, the food you eat, and the lotions you rub into your skin.

Biomonitoring studies detect phthalates in more than 75% of the population, with women showing consistently higher levels, thanks in part to cosmetics, fragrances, and hair products that are disproportionately marketed to them.

Pregnant women and their babies are especially vulnerable.  Phthalates cross the placenta, entering fetal circulation during critical windows of development.  Researchers now worry that this early exposure may pre-program a child’s biology for higher cancer risk decades later.

How phthalates hijack the breast

The breast is an endocrine-responsive organ, meaning it’s exquisitely sensitive to hormonal signals.  Phthalates mimic and mangle these signals with alarming precision.  The study highlights several ways these chemicals act like biochemical saboteurs:

  • Oncogene activation: Phthalates switch on genes that drive uncontrolled cell growth while silencing those that normally trigger damaged cells to self-destruct.

  • Xenoestrogenic effects: Compounds like BBP and DEHP can act as “fake estrogens,” binding to estrogen receptors and fueling hormone-driven cancers.

  • Survival pathways: By activating PI3K/AKT/mTOR, a pathway that tells cells to grow, divide, and avoid death, phthalates essentially gift tumor cells with immortality.

  • Metastasis enablers: They promote ep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T), a process that helps cancer cells slip their moorings and invade new tissues.  They also stimulate angiogenesis, building new blood vessels that feed hungry tumors.

The result?  A body environment far more conducive to tumor growth and spread.

When everyday chemicals turn deadly

What makes phthalates especially dangerous is not that they cause breast cancer outright, but that they may accelerate every step of its progression – from the first cellular misfire to metastatic disease.  Think of them as accelerants poured onto a slow-burning fire.

Epidemiological evidence is still mixed, with some studies showing stronger associations than others.  But when researchers put breast cells in a dish, the results are chillingly consistent: phthalate exposure increases cancer cell survival, motility, and invasiveness.

In one striking experiment, women stopped using personal care products with parabens and phthalates for just 28 days.  The genetic profile of their breast tissue shifted – cancer-related pathways began to quiet down.  It’s a glimpse of how quickly the body can respond when exposure is reduced.

What you can do to reduce your risks

You can’t escape phthalates completely, but you can lower your exposure.  Simple steps include:

  • Choose fragrance-free or phthalate-free personal care products.

  • Avoid microwaving food in plastic containers.

  • Limit canned and heavily packaged foods.

  • Use glass, stainless steel, or silicone alternatives whenever possible.
